Buying Guide for Lock Closet Sliding Door
Understanding Why I Need a Lock for My Closet Sliding Door
When I decided to secure my closet sliding door, I realized it wasn’t just about privacy but also about protecting valuable or sensitive items inside. A lock adds an extra layer of security and peace of mind. Before buying, I assessed what level of security I actually needed based on my lifestyle and who else has access to the area.
Types of Locks Suitable for Sliding Closet Doors
I learned there are several lock options designed specifically for sliding doors, including hook locks, sliding bolt locks, and keyed locks. Each type offers different levels of security and ease of installation. For instance, hook locks latch onto the frame, while keyed locks might require drilling. I considered which type would best suit the door material and how often I’d need to lock or unlock it.
Measuring and Assessing My Door
Before purchasing, I carefully measured the thickness and height of my sliding door and checked the frame structure. This was crucial because some locks only fit doors within certain dimensions. I also inspected how the door slides to ensure the lock wouldn’t interfere with its smooth operation.
Material and Durability
Since I want my lock to last, I looked for locks made from sturdy materials like stainless steel or heavy-duty metal. Durability is important because sliding doors often endure repeated use, and a flimsy lock might break or wear out quickly.
Ease of Installation
I prefer locks that I can install myself without professional help. Some locks come with simple mounting kits and clear instructions. I checked if the lock requires drilling, adhesive, or clamps, and whether my door and frame could accommodate those installation methods.
Security Features to Consider
I evaluated features such as whether the lock can be locked from both sides, if it has a key or combination mechanism, and how resistant it is to tampering. For added security, I looked for locks with anti-pick or anti-drill designs.
